Output 64fd9eb1b782a073fbaf5c16dbfe5cf990aa128b418d3c0845c8a21e8a3bae01:0

value
501626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9543b018eff0daf2aae84a1ab06d8684875b9805 OP_EQUALVERIFY OP_CHECKSIG
address
1EcEmcuioRg59HxYSCFsY4TE1c47Ezfd7G
transaction
64fd9eb1b782a073fbaf5c16dbfe5cf990aa128b418d3c0845c8a21e8a3bae01
spent
true